#537d28 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#537d28 is composed of 32.5% red, 49%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 68%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 89.6 degrees, a saturation of 51.5% and a lightness of 32.4%. #537d28 color hex could be obtained by blending #a6fa50 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#537d28 color description : Dark moderate green.
The hexadecimal color #537d28 has RGB values of R:83, G:125,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0.34, M:0, Y:0.68,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 5471528.
